REPORTS TO: General Manager


Job Summary:

The Events and Operations Manager assists the General Manager and Assistant General Manager in the day-to-day operations of RCSH restaurant. This role is directly accountable for the supervision and management of front-of-house bar operations, hosts, and servers. The manager maintains the highest quality of beverage and service standards, cleanliness, sanitation, and safety. In the absence of the General Manager, the manager oversees and coordinates activities concerning all front-of-the-house operations. Success is real growth in sales, profit, and market share, and is the result of living The Sizzle for our employees and guests.

In this role, you will also assist with generating new and repeat banquet and catering sales, actively network and promote the brand within the community, and greet the hosts of private dining events, which are primarily held in the evenings and on weekends. The role involves supporting event coordination, driving customer satisfaction, and maintaining high operational standards.


Key Responsibilities:


Operational Support:

  • Assist the General Manager in overseeing daily restaurant operations to ensure efficiency and high standards of service.
  • Help implement and enforce company policies, procedures, and standards as directed by the General Manager.
  • Supervise day-to-day operations to ensure all standards of RCSH quality and service are achieved during each shift.
  • Provide ongoing coaching and appropriate progressive discipline to all Team Members, managing appropriate documentation and ensuring each Team Member has clarity around their current level of performance.
  • Increase sales in the restaurant by providing the highest levels of uncompromising quality of food, beverage, reception, greeting, seating, and service.
  • Conduct first interviews and recommend hires to the General Manager and Chef.
  • Provide orientation and training according to all RCSH training systems, standards, and manuals for new hires.
  • Construct the weekly work schedule to meet the demands of the business.
  • Supervise operations and Team Members to ensure that all cleaning, maintenance, housekeeping, and side work duties are accomplished in line with operations standards.
  • Proactively communicate with the General Manager and other members of the management team to share and convey information regarding the restaurant.
  • Maintain familiarity with all national, state, and local safety, health, and sanitation standards and ensure all Team Members are following guidelines appropriately.
  • Maintain a strong presence on the restaurant floor, engaging with guests to ensure satisfaction.
  • Address and resolve customer complaints and concerns in a professional manner.
  • Implement strategies to improve guest experience and increase guest loyalty.
  • Correctly perform all duties necessary to close the restaurant.
  • Additional duties as assigned.


Event Coordination:

  • Support the General Manager in planning, coordinating, and executing events within the restaurant, including private parties, corporate gatherings, and special promotions.
  • Collaborate with clients to understand their event needs and ensure their expectations are met.
  • Work closely with the kitchen and service staff to deliver seamless event experiences.
  • Assist in managing event budgets, timelines, and logistics.
  • Utilize the Tripleseat discussion templates and event contract to interact with Private Dining guests via phone and/or email to confirm event details and answer any questions.
  • Follow up with guests post-event to ensure satisfaction.
  • Communicate all event details to the local Restaurant Management, ensuring 100% clarity of details and expectations.
  • Keep records of guest contact information, interactions, and transactions in the reservation system and Tripleseat.
  • Generate reports within the event booking management software as requested.
  • Assist in the coordination of private dining menu requests.
  • Backup for Regional Sales Manager in restaurant location.
  • Manage Private Dining events on the books successfully and work pipeline of inquiries, prospects, tentative, and definite bookings.
  • Work closely with the Regional Sales Manager to generate new business and maintain contact with present accounts.
  • Assist the Regional Sales Manager with Private Dining events from organization to execution, including delegation of responsibilities to the Restaurant Team.
  • Administrative duties assigned as needed.
  • Additional duties as assigned.
